随着互联网技术的飞速发展,网络安全问题日益凸显,在众多网络安全威胁中,DNS劫持作为一种新型的网络攻击手段,给全球互联网用户带来了极大的安全隐患,作为网络基础设施的重要组成部分,CDN厂商在保障网络安全方面发挥着举足轻重的作用,本文将围绕CDN厂商如何进行DNS劫持检测展开探讨,共同守护网络空间的安全与稳定。
DNS劫持简介
DNS劫持是指攻击者通过手段欺骗DNS服务器,将用户原本请求的域名解析到恶意地址上,从而实现用户无法访问目标网站或获取重要信息的目的,这种攻击方式具有隐蔽性强、危害范围广的特点,对网络安全构成了严重威胁。
CDN厂商在DNS劫持检测中的角色
CDN厂商作为网络服务的提供者,承载着大量的用户请求和数据传输,CDN厂商在DNS劫持检测方面具有天然的优势,CDN厂商可以利用其遍布全球的节点资源,实时监测DNS请求的变化情况;CDN厂商具备强大的数据处理和分析能力,可以对异常流量进行快速识别和处理。
CDN厂商DNS劫持检测的主要方法
- 基于黑名单的检测机制
黑名单机制是指将已经知的恶意域名添加到黑名单中,当CDN厂商检测到请求解析到黑名单中的域名时,即可判定为DNS劫持行为,这种检测机制简单有效,但存在一定的误报率和漏报率。
- 基于白名单的检测机制
与黑名单机制相反,白名单机制是将可信的域名添加到白名单中,只有白名单中的域名才能被正确解析,当CDN厂商检测到请求解析到的域名不在白名单中时,即可判定为DNS劫持行为,这种检测机制准确性较高,但需要不断更新和维护白名单。
- 基于行为的检测机制
行为检测机制是通过对用户请求的正常模式进行学习和分析,从而识别出异常流量,当CDN厂商发现某个请求的行为与正常模式存在显著差异时,即可判定为DNS劫持行为,这种检测机制具有较强的实时性和准确性,但需要大量的训练数据和计算资源。
CDN厂商DNS劫持检测的意义
CDN厂商进行DNS劫持检测不仅有助于保护用户的隐私和信息安全,还能有效降低自身的法律责任风险,通过加强DNS劫持检测能力,CDN厂商还能提升自身的竞争力和市场地位,为用户提供更加优质、安全的网络服务。
DNS劫持是当前网络安全领域面临的重要挑战之一,CDN厂商作为网络基础设施的守护者,有责任也有能力通过DNS劫持检测等手段保障网络安全,只有共同努力,才能构建一个安全、稳定、繁荣的互联网空间。